About Daiki Nakamura

Daiki Nakamura (中村 大樹, Nakamura Daiki) is a Japanese voice actor affiliated with 81 Produce. Some of his best-known works include Gaine in The Brave Express Might Gaine and Grandpa in Grandpa Danger.
